One among the most important discoveries in pain investigate was that the brain consists of substances which have the exact same pharmacological Homes as plant-derived opiates and synthetic opioid prescription drugs. These substances, known as endogenous opioid peptides, axe existing within just nerve cells from the peripheral and central anxious systems (Palkovits, 1984).

The sensory factors issue detecting, localizing, examining the intensity of, and determining the stimulus. Concentrating on the sensory areas, anyone could explain her or his pain to be a gentle burning pain Situated to the again in the hand. In contrast, the affective or unpleasantness facet of pain correlates Using the aversive push to terminate proleviate blocks pain receptors the noxious stimulus and is particularly described by phrases that aren't specifically tied to a sensory encounter, as an example, nagging, awkward, or excruciating.

For DEER, protein samples are flash-frozen, As a result freezing each receptor molecule in a specific conformation, and investigated by electron paramagnetic resonance spectroscopy at fifty K. The measurable distances within the ensemble are if possible from the two–five nm array. The DEER information of the µOR, labelled at positions 182 within the intracellular close of your transmembrane helix (TM) four and 276 on TM6, may very well be defined best by a sum of 6 distances. Four of those ended up deemed being fascinating, as they adjusted on agonist software and will be matched to substantial-resolution constructions (Fig. one). Each individual of these distances represents at the very least one particular putative conformation on the µOR. Based on our comprehension of GPCR activation, the two shorter distances have been assigned to inactive conformations whereas the longer kinds ended up assigned to Energetic conformations. Partial agonists experienced negligible effect on the basal conformational distribution, and even the complete agonist DAMGO compelled only a small proportion from the receptor into Energetic conformations. This discovering is reminiscent of the initial crystal buildings of agonist-sure β2-adrenergic receptors, which resembled inactive receptors to the intracellular side3 Except if G-protein or G-protein-mimicking nanobodies ended up current.
